BUNCHE MIDDLE SCHOOL

Bunche Middle is a Title I public middle school that is part of the Compton Unified school district, located in Compton, CA with about 414 students offering grade levels from 6th Grade to 8th Grade.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 15 teachers, Bunche Middle has a student/teacher ratio of about 27: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

Ralph J. Bunche Middle School is a public middle school located in Compton, California, serving students within the Compton Unified School District. Named after the distinguished diplomat and Nobel Peace Prize laureate Ralph Bunche, the school is situated on Mona Boulevard and functions as a key educational hub for the local community. It is committed to fostering a supportive learning environment that emphasizes academic growth, personal development, and college and career readiness for its diverse student body.

As part of the Compton Unified School District, Bunche Middle School provides a curriculum aligned with state standards, often integrating technology and extracurricular opportunities to engage students during their critical middle school years. The school works closely with district leadership to implement initiatives aimed at improving student outcomes and maintaining strong community ties. School Demographics for 414 students

The primary ethnicity of students attending BUNCHE MIDDLE SCHOOL is predominantly Hispanic/Latino, representing about 88% of the student body.
